I have some good running news and some bad running news to share. You ready for it?

Good news: I ran 5 miles in my new sneakers with almost zero pain! Hooray!

I did a 5-mile Tempo Run outside, which included a mile warm-up, three miles at 8:39 pace, and a mile cool down:

  • Mile 1: 9:22
  • Mile 2: 8:36
  • Mile 3: 8:36
  • Mile 4: 8:45
  • Mile 5: 9:41

After running three miles at 8:39 pace, I was totally spent. The final mile of my run was especially tough– I even stopped to walk for a little bit. Even still, it was a good workout. I’m just happy to be running again!
